Factors Affecting Cost
- Severity of the Crack: Minor hairline cracks may cost less to repair compared to larger, more severe cracks.
- Location of the Crack: Cracks in easily accessible areas are generally cheaper to fix than those in hard-to-reach spots.
- Foundation Material: The type of material, such as concrete or brick, can affect the cost of the repair.
- Repair Method: Different methods like epoxy injections, polyurethane foam, or carbon fiber reinforcement have varying costs.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Sterling, VA can influence the overall cost, with more experienced contractors often charging higher rates.
Common Tasks and Costs
| Task | Average Cost (Sterling, VA) |
|---|---|
| Minor Hairline Crack Repair | $300 - $500 |
| Moderate Crack Repair | $500 - $1,000 |
| Severe Crack Repair |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Epoxy Injection | $400 - $800 |
| Polyurethane Foam Injection | $450 - $900 |
| Carbon Fiber Reinforcement | $600 - $1,200 |
